Commission approves Friends of Warner Parks headquarters plan at 50 Vaughn Road with archaeology condition

The Historic Zoning Commission voted Jan. 15 to approve a new office building for the Friends of Warner Parks at 50 Vaughn Road in Edwin Warner Park, with conditions on final materials and an archaeological survey.
Staff said the design mimics the WPA-era park structures and that the proposed height, scale, location, roof forms and window/door patterns meet the design guidelines for the landmark park. Staff recommended approval with conditions that the commission sign off on final material selections and that an archaeological survey be completed; the applicant has already coordinated with the department archaeologist.
Emily Wilson Hamm, the architect representing Friends of Warner Parks, told the commission the team agreed with the staff recommendations and had scheduled coordination with the staff archaeologist.
Commissioners voted to approve the project with the recommended conditions. Staff will review final material samples and the archaeology results prior to issuing final approvals.
